As part of the Integrated Health and Agriculture Intervention Project for Housing (PIISAH), a team of technicians has just been deployed to the Afanloum site.

The Afanloum site is now abuzz with activity as part of a major scientific and environmental expedition. For the past few days, teams of specialized technicians have been traversing its forests, armed with compasses, measuring tapes, and data sheets.

This field deployment marks the official launch of the systematic inventory of local forest resources, a crucial step in the PIISAH project. By venturing beneath the canopy, these experts are not simply conducting a technical inventory; they are laying the foundations for a sustainable development model capable of enhancing the value of the natural heritage while protecting the fragile ecosystems of this rich locality.

The objective of this inventory campaign is to establish a comprehensive and scientific catalog of the plant species present on the site. The research is structured around three major and complementary categories. First, technicians are cataloging fruit tree species, true pillars of food security and the local economy for the surrounding communities.

Second, the focus is on large trees, these giants of the forest essential for climate regulation, carbon sequestration, and the preservation of overall biodiversity. Finally, the inventory gives prominence to plants used in traditional medicine, an invaluable resource for community health and the safeguarding of ancestral therapeutic heritage.

This initiative of the PIISAH project addresses the dual challenge of conservation and sustainable forest management. At a time when deforestation and climate change threaten the forests of Central Africa, having an accurate database on the flora of Afanloum is a strategic imperative.

This assessment will make it possible to identify rare or endangered species in order to implement appropriate protection measures, while also promoting harmonious coexistence between human infrastructure and the surrounding natural environment.

Local communities, often custodians of centuries-old knowledge about these plants, are closely involved in this process, which recognizes their role as guardians of the forest.By combining the rigor of modern forestry with the wealth of local knowledge, the deployment at the Afanloum site has become a project of national significance.

The data collected by field technicians will serve as a compass for decision-makers to guide future land-use planning.
